March Madness begins this week and I want to pick your brains.

I play in a Pick 8 pool. You have to pick 8 teams whose seeds have to add up to 32 or more. Ergo, you can't pick four No. 1's and four number 2's. You have to pick some higher seeds who might get you a few wins.

Your thoughts on possible dark horses and sure things would be greatly appreciated.
